| HIST |
The houses he built are still considered some of the best houses in the area. He was active in civic affairs and served as president of the Houston Rotary Club, member of the Houston School Board, and director on the GIrl Scouts board. of Houston, Texas, and Columbia, South Carolina of Houston, Texas [3, 4] |
| Occupation |
a noted architect in Texas; he was one of Houston’s outstanding architects; he specialized in the design of fine mansions in the exclusive River Oaks suburb and built Howard Hughes’s home, among others [2, 4] |
